    Ted Healy (born Charles Ernest Lee Nash; October 1, 1896 – December 21, 1937) was an American vaudeville performer, comedian, and actor.

  2. Mar 20, 2021 · Ted Healy was the creator and leader of the Three Stooges, but his life was marred by conflicts, alcoholism, and violence. He died in 1937 under mysterious circumstances, sparking rumors of a mob attack and a coverup.
